If the type of diabetes that the patient has is not documented in the medical record, E11 codes for type 2 diabetes should be used as a default. If the medical record doesn’t say what type of diabetes the patient has but indicates that the patient uses insulin, the Type 2 diabetes codes should also be used.

Diabetic peripheral neuropathy (DPN), a common and troublesome complication in patients with type 2 diabetes mellitus (T2DM), contributes to a higher risk of diabetic foot ulcer and lower limb amputation. These situations can negatively impact the quality of life of affected individuals.
Proximal neuropathy (diabetic polyradiculopathy) Unlike peripheral neuropathy, which affects the ends of nerves in the feet, legs, hands and arms, proximal neuropathy affects nerves in the thighs, hips, buttocks or legs. This condition is more common in people who have type 2 diabetes and in older adults.
Polyneuropathy is when multiple peripheral nerves become damaged, which is also commonly called peripheral neuropathy.
Peripheral neuropathy is a type of nerve damage that typically affects the feet and legs and sometimes affects the hands and arms. This type of neuropathy is very common. About one-third to one-half of people with diabetes have peripheral neuropathy.

Diabetic neuropathy is a type of nerve damage that occurs in people who have diabetes. There are four types: autonomic, peripheral, proximal, and focal neuropathy. Each affects a different set of nerves and has a different range of effects. Autonomic neuropathy harms automatic processes in the body, such as digestion.
Proximal neuropathy This type of nerve damage is usually only on one side of the body and can affect the hip, buttock, or thigh. Proximal neuropathy can cause severe pain and difficulty with movement, as well as weight and muscle loss.
Significant nerve problems (clinical neuropathy) can develop within the first 10 years after a diabetes diagnosis. The risk of developing neuropathy increases the longer you have diabetes. About half of people with diabetes have some form of neuropathy.
Diabetic neuropathy is a type of nerve damage that can occur if you have diabetes. High blood sugar (glucose) can injure nerves throughout the body. Diabetic neuropathy most often damages nerves in the legs and feet.
Mortality is higher in people with cardiovascular autonomic neuropathy (CAN). The overall mortality rate over periods up to 10 years was 27% in patients with DM and CAN detected, compared with a 5% mortality rate in those without evidence of CAN. Morbidity results from foot ulceration and lower-extremity amputation.

Like proximal neuropathy, most focal neuropathies go away in a few weeks or months and leave no lasting damage. The most common type is carpal tunnel syndrome. Although most don't feel the symptoms of carpal tunnel syndrome, about 25 percent of people with diabetes have some degree of nerve compression at the wrist.
Diabetic neuropathy symptoms usually begin in the toes and work their way towards the head. The first symptoms you may experience are tingling and numbness in the toes or fingers. This may resemble the feeling of “pins and needles” when a foot that has fallen asleep begins to wake up.

As stated previously, in ICD-10, most diabetes codes do not require an additional code to describe the complication. However, there are a few exceptions. One exception is diabetes with CKD. Here, coding guidelines ask for the specific stage of CKD to be specified.

Just like ICD-9, ICD-10 has different chapters for the different types of diabetes. The table below presents the major types of diabetes, by chapters, in both ICD coding versions. Diabetes Coding Comparison ICD-9-CM ICD-10-CM 249._ - Secondary diabetes mellitus E08._ - Diabetes mellitus due to underlying condition E09._ - Drug or chemical induced diabetes mellitus E13._ - Other specified diabetes mellitus 250._ - Diabetes mellitus E10._ - Type 1 diabetes mellitus E11._ - Type 2 diabetes mellitus 648._ - Diabetes mellitus of mother, complicating pregnancy, childbirth, or the puerperium O24._ - Gestational diabetes mellitus in pregnancy 775.1 - Neonatal diabetes mellitus P70.2 - Neonatal diabetes mellitus This coding structure for diabetes in ICD-10 is very important to understand and remember, as it is virtually always the starting point in assigning codes for all patient encounters seen and treated for diabetes. Most of the neuropathy ICD 10 codes are located in Chapter-6 of ICD-10-CM manual which is “diseases of the nervous system”, code range G00-G 99
Neuropathic pain should be coded as neuralgia M79.2, not neuropathy.
Polyneuropathy – Two or more nerves in different areas get affected. Autonomic neuropathy – Affects the nerves which control blood pressure, sweating, digestion, heart rate, bowel and bladder emptying.
Peripheral neuropathy with diabetes should be coded as E11.42 (DM with polyneuropath), not e11.40 (DM with neuropathy).
Autonomic neuropathy symptoms can be heart intolerance, excess sweat or no sweat, blood pressure changes, bladder, bowel or digestive problems. Physician does a thorough physical examination including extremity neurological exam and noting vitals.
Detailed history of the patient like symptoms, lifestyle and exposure to toxins may also help to diagnose neuropathy. Blood tests, CT, MRI, electromyography, nerve biopsy and skin biopsy are the tests used to confirm neuropathy.

For gestational diabetes (diabetes that occurs during pregnancy) women should be assigned a code under the 024.4 subheading and not any other codes under the 024 category.
The code for long-term use of insulin, Z79.4, should also be used in these cases (unless insulin was just given to the patient as a one-time fix to bring blood sugar under control).
ICD-10 codes refer to the codes from the 10th Revision of the classification system. ICD-10 officially replaced ICD-9 in the US in October of 2015.
The switch to ICD-10 was a response to the need for doctors to record more specific and accurate diagnoses based on the most recent advancements in medicine. For this reason, there are five times more ICD-10 codes than there were ICD-9 codes. The ICD-10 codes consist of three to seven characters that may contain both letters and numbers.
The “unspecified” codes can be used when not enough information is known to give a more specific diagnosis; in that case, “unspecified” is technically more accurate than a more specific but as yet unconfirmed diagnosis. For more guidelines on using ICD-10 codes for diabetes mellitus, you can consult this document.
The more characters in the code, the more specific the diagnosis, so when writing a code on a medical record you should give the longest code possible while retaining accuracy.
